Seznam změn - 29.500 Changelog - 29.500

Heroes and Heroines!

The next update is just around the corner. While we continue to work on further features and adjustments, this time we are bringing various changes to Expeditions, the Black Market, and Deeds & Titles. You will also find several bug fixes in this update.

General Adjustments

Expeditions

We are making some minor adjustments to Expeditions. We are planning more for future updates and are keeping a very close eye on your feedback.

  • You can no longer receive 1x Hourglass and 10x Hourglass at the same time.

  • You can no longer find Keys and Bounties in the final clearing.

    • This should help you collect more points

  • All swords in the Sword Trial now grant 1 additional point.

    • Your feedback showed that the Sword Expedition was too difficult. Adjusting the points should help with completion.

    • Sword in the Stone now gives 6 Heroism, the Bent Sword gives 3 Heroism, and the Broken Sword now only gives minus 4 Heroism.

Deeds and Titles

We are making several adjustments to Deeds and Titles. We continue to evaluate your feedback to improve this feature in the future.

  • The Glory Deed "One for All" can now only be obtained twice a day.

    • We are not making changes to already earned Deeds. If you already have them, you keep them.

  • A new Deed, "Mushroom Expert," is now available.

  • In the Hall of Fame, the detailed view no longer shows the player's profile, but directly displays their Glory Bookshelf.

Black Market

We received feedback that you would like more variety in the Black Market offers. We have expanded the Black Market with both standard and event-specific offers.

  • You will receive 3 fixed offers every week and 3 additional random offers in new slots. This means you will get a total of 6 offers in the Black Market each week. The following items can be part of the random offers:

    • Potions (Dexterity, Strength, Intelligence, Constitution) are now available for Mushrooms. The size depends on your level.

    • Arcane Splinters, Metal, Wood, Stone, and Souls are now available for Mushrooms.

Hellevator

We are also expanding the Black Market during events. You already saw this with the last World Boss; now we are doing the same for the Hellevator. You can now directly buy or sell Key Cards. These offers are limited and only available for the duration of the event.

  • Key Cards can be purchased for Lucky Coins.

  • Key Cards can be purchased for Mushrooms.

  • Lucky Coins can be purchased for Key Cards.

  • Hourglasses can be purchased for Key Cards.

Offers & Sales

Until now, new sales and offers were generally linked to events. This is no longer the case. In the future, you will see new offers and special sales more often that are not directly connected to in-game events.

  • Sales now have a new icon in the city view. They will no longer be displayed with the events.

Improvements

  • Shop Icons: Items in the shops now have an icon indicating item quality.

  • Average Quality: You can now view your average item quality in your character's Info tab.

  • Underworld Recruitment: It is now possible to recruit units in the Underworld by holding down the Plus (+) button.

  • Performance & Notifications: We have made several adjustments to our Push Notifications and performance.

    • With EU25, we already implemented many changes that resulted in zero lag or DC issues during the new server start.

    • Push Notifications have received further adjustments.

    • Several performance upgrades have been implemented.

Fixed Bugs

  • Potions: Resolved an issue where potions could not be consumed via the context menu despite having free slots.

  • Adventure Missions: Fixed inconsistent quest-giver texts to ensure they match the actual missions.

  • VIP Badge: Corrected the erroneous display of the VIP badge over inventory tabs in various shop screens (e.g., Witch, Blacksmith, Magic Shop).

  • Library of Meticulousness: The drop chance for Legendary Gems now shows decimal places to match actual calculations (no more rounding to whole percentages).

  • Legendary Dungeon: Fixed a tooltip error for guaranteed weapon drops where square brackets were incorrectly displayed.

  • Legendary Dungeon: Fixed a visual bug where decorative elements (chain with emblem and sword) were shifted upwards on the run selection screen and loot chests.

  • Legendary Dungeon: Fixed a rare bug where the Deeds popup could block the gem selection after a boss fight.

  • Legendary Dungeon (Floor 4): The Key Merchant indicator is now correctly displayed on the map again.

  • To-Do List: Fixed a display error where the daily list was incorrectly labeled as the "Beginner List" (or vice-versa) before opening.

  • Adventuromatic: Fixed a bug where pressing the Enter key to collect thirst for adventure caused the window to open multiple times and get stuck.

  • Interface: Fixed a rare error when switching from landscape to portrait mode that caused incorrect resource displays, wrong server names, and faulty item interactions.

  • Landscape View: Fixed overlapping tooltip texts during item comparisons.

  • Deeds & Titles: Fixed a bug in the Hall of Fame popups where deleted characters (Ranks 1–3) showed glitched names; they now display "Deleted."

  • Mailbox: Resolved overlapping text and images in messages for purchased packs (e.g., World Boss Sale).

  • Quests: Fixed a bug where switching through classic quests added extra lines to the red mouseover display for adventure time reduction.

  • Whirlwind & Sandstorm: The "waiting time not expired" message no longer incorrectly appears after fights where the player has over 90% HP.

  • Fortress & Underworld: Fixed a bug where the "Under Construction" icon didn't appear immediately or remained visible after canceling a build.

  • Guild Attacks: Fixed a display error where attack costs appeared red (insufficient gold) in the guild menu but yellow in the Hall of Fame.

  • Account Import (EU): Fixed a bug in the import dialog for merged EU worlds that showed only the merged world instead of the original server selection.

  • Character Screen: Fixed an issue where equipment changes, potions, gems, and rune swaps were only visible in the stats after reopening the character screen.
